Ticket: FeedCheck vault locked — plugin signing stalled

Hey plugin folks — the Castwren vault that holds the FeedCheck validator signing certs auto-locked after last night's restart, so new plugin submissions are queued, not lost. Validation resumes once we unseal it; expect a backlog sweep afterward. Maintainers on rotation can reopen it with the recovery passphrase given directly below.

strongbox words: zoreth-fraox-oliius-aldeth-jorax-praeth-holmir-drumir-prawyn

Ticket: Read-replica lag alarm drifted out of sync — again.

So the Quillhaven replica lag alarm fired all weekend, and it turns out someone hand-tweaked the threshold on prod back in March and nobody ported it to the config repo. Staging still has the old value, which is why our dry runs never caught it. Suggest we pin these in Loomcast and block manual overrides. Raising for the weekly sync so we can agree on ownership. Current prod values, pulled this morning, are as follows.

settings of tagef-bawif:
DRUIX_HOST=druix.zemvarlabs.internal
DRUIX_PORT=8000

**Step 4 — Enable the Fareline pricing experiment**

Before flipping the `fareline_tiered_pricing` flag, confirm the experiment cohort table has been seeded and that rollback snapshots exist for both price books. Verify row counts match the pre-migration export exactly. Once confirmed, point the pricing worker at the experiment database using the connection string below.

replica DSN, kajep-yahag: mssql://praok_svc:iF@db-8d68.plorvaio.local:5432/eliion

## 2.14.0 — Timezone defaults changed

Report exports in Tallygrove now default to the workspace timezone instead of UTC. Scheduled exports created before this release keep their old behavior; new ones pick up the workspace setting automatically. The export scheduler ships with the updated defaults shown below.

settings of fafog-haduf:
ZORIX_PIN=4648
ZORIX_METRICS_HOST=metrics.zorix.paliqsys.corp
ZORIX_LOG_LEVEL=info
ZORIX_TENANT=druix